Binary package hint: r-base

When using compiz transparency effects (fading windows), device windows (I think they're x-windows) opened by the package R (R-base) do not follow the transparency rules.

Steps to reproduce:

Enable compiz opacify plug in.
Set passive opacity to arbitrary value (eg 20).
Open terminal
Start R by typing the letter "R" (without quotes)
Create a plot by typing:
    x<-1:5
    y<-2:6
    plot(x,y)

Notice that mousing onto an active window, away form the plot graphic created by R does not allow the graph window to fade.
